And now an emerald theme using my own moving buttons.
Just get the link for it from the image and import it with the emerald theme manager.

Image
Cathbard Mint

This is now available in a deb. You can download it from here.
If you have my repo enabled it can be installed with:
sudo aptitude install cathbard-emerald-cathbard-mint
